Even If Sanctions Are Relaxed, Iran Stands on the Brink of Economic Disaster
A favorable deal won’t be enough to save the Islamic Republic.
May 7, 2026
A favorable deal won’t be enough to save the Islamic Republic.
If Tehran and Washington conclude an agreement that ends the current war, it would likely involve a relaxation of economic sanctions. Patrick Clawson examines the possible consequences for the Islamic Republic.
